Course Learning Objectives

The objective of the course is to use economic analysis to think about countries that operate in a globalized context, narrating and discussing global economic events and debates of the early 21st century, with main emphasis on the macro and economic growth dimensions.

CONTENT

1. World Economy of the Early 21st Century

¿ Brief Historical Account
¿ The Long Shadow of the Great Recession
¿ Agenda

2. Global Economy Debates

¿ Money & Finance and the Debate on Banking Regulation
¿ Public Debt, Welfare State and the Austerity Debate
¿ The Secular Stagnation Debate
¿ The Debate on Inequality
¿ Populism & the Future of Globalization
¿ The Debate on Climate Change

Methodology

Lecturing will be combined with class presentations and discussions. Working in groups, participants will prepare selected topics and present them to the class. Then debate, basic guiding lecturing and wrap up will follow. Each topic will involve presentations based on a combination of selected core materials from academic, policy and specialized media sources. These materials will be complemented by participants with additional external sources coming from their own exploration of the topic.
